ABOUT THE ROLE

We’re adding our first Strategic Programs Account Executive focused on converting free users into thriving Team Edition customers through our special growth programs (Startups, Nonprofits, Y Combinator companies, and more).

This is a brand new role at Fathom, giving you the opportunity to help define how we serve our early-stage and mission-driven customers. You’ll work primarily with inbound accounts — answering product questions, running tailored demos, showcasing the value of our Team Edition plans, and helping new users activate through special promos. You’ll also collaborate with Sales and Marketing to drive new interest through targeted campaigns.

If you love building relationships, helping customers succeed, and shaping new programs, this is a unique opportunity to make a major impact on our 2025 growth.

Core Responsibilities:

  • Drive growth by converting eligible free accounts (nonprofits, startups, YC companies) into thriving Team Edition customers.

  • Deliver consultative product education through tailored demos, helping users clearly understand the value of upgrading.

  • Negotiate and close promo-based subscription plans that balance customer needs with Fathom’s growth goals.

  • Expand program awareness by partnering with Sales and Marketing to generate new interest and bring in more high-potential users.

  • Ensure a smooth handoff to Customer Success to set new customers up for activation, adoption, and long-term success.

WHO WE THINK WILL THRIVE (aka Requirements):

  • 2+ years of closing experience, preferably in a SaaS company (bonus points for experience in a PLG or self-serve-led environment).

  • Proven ability to run consultative, solution-focused sales conversations with inbound leads.

  • Comfortable demoing SaaS products and tailoring messaging to different customer profiles.

  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ills (you’ll be guiding some very smart prospects!).

  • Highly collaborative — excited to work closely with Marketing, Sales, and CS.

  • Must be located in the US or Canada.

What you need to know about the Charlotte Tech Scene

Ranked among the hottest tech cities in 2024 by CompTIA, Charlotte is quickly cementing its place as a major U.S. tech hub. Home to more than 90,000 tech workers, the city’s ecosystem is primed for continued growth, fueled by billions in annual funding from heavyweights like Microsoft and RevTech Labs, which has created thousands of fintech jobs and made the city a go-to for tech pros looking for their next big opportunity.

Key Facts About Charlotte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 90,859; 6.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lowe’s, Bank of America, TIAA, Microsoft, Honeywell
  • Key Industries: Fintech, artificial intelligence, cybersecurity, cloud computing, e-commerce
  •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(CED)
  • Notable Investors: Microsoft, Google, Falfurrias Management Partners, RevTech Labs Foundation
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of North Carolina at Charlotte, Northeastern University, North Carolina Research Campus
